Joy and Smiles to the World
There we were sitting comfortably in the light dimmed concert hall. the candles up front glowed expectantly, announcing that something special was about to happen. We always looked forward to this High School Christmas concert. Listening to good Christmas music always started the season off in a special way. As the choirs began moving in procession down the aisle the song rung out, Joy to the World the Lord Has Come. It was a beautiful start, except for one problem, the words were not reflected in their faces. Very few choir members were smiling. If there was joy in their hearts, it wasnt being displayed in their faces. So begins my encouragement to you this Christmas season. Let the joy of Christmas fill your lives and your relationships this Advent.
Its time to bring a smile to the people around you and joy to your own heart as you think of the Christ child, Gods gift to the world. Take it to heart to bring laughter and smiles to the people that you are with this year. Dress up as Santa and deliver gifts. Drop by with cookies to a family in the neighborhood that you dont know. Go caroling with your antler hat on (hunting season is over). Shovel your neighbors snow (yes, its here) with your canoe paddle. Smile, and say Merry Christmas to the strangers you meet wihle shopping. Tell a good Santa joke. Tell a frustrated sales clerk that they are doing a fantastic job. Make a meal for your family, if thats not your normal task. Give free Christmas Hugs. Buy gifts for the needy. Bake Christmas cookies to share. Invite your neighbors to the Childrens Christmas Production It Happened in the Country.
Be creative and let the world know that the songs you sing tell the sotry of what is in your hearts. Spread the Joy of Christmas, its contagious.
